About the Role

Sierra is building a platform to help businesses create better customer experiences using AI. This role will partner with Agent Development leadership to provide operational rigor, visibility into business health, and drive expansion strategies. You will also leverage AI-native tools to build internal systems and automate workflows.

Responsibilities

  • Serve as the strategy and operations partner to Agent Dev leadership.
  • Bring operational rigor to Agent Dev similar to that powering the Sales organization.
  • Partner with Agent Dev leaders to provide clear visibility into business health, including pipeline, deployment progress, utilization, expansion opportunities, and risks.
  • Help define and scale the playbook for building, evaluating, launching, and expanding AI agents at large enterprises.
  • Work closely with account teams to identify whitespace, prioritize expansion opportunities, and build repeatable motions for revenue growth.
  • Analyze complex datasets and translate findings into executive-ready recommendations.
  • Leverage AI-native tools such as Claude Code, Cursor, and Codex to build lightweight internal systems, automate workflows, and create operational leverage.

Requirements

  • 3-5 years of experience in management consulting, investment banking, private equity, or strategy and operations at top-tier technology companies.
  • Strong analytical rigor with the ability to work with large datasets and translate analysis into executive-ready insights and clear business actions.
  • Demonstrated experience supporting sales, post-sales, or commercial teams in a strategy and operations capacity.
  • Comfort with ambiguity and fast-changing environments, with the ability to independently structure complex problems and drive them to resolution.
  • Commercial instinct and business judgment, with a clear understanding of how enterprise technology products are landed, deployed, and expanded.
  • Strong communication skills, with the ability to influence senior stakeholders and act as a trusted advisor.
  • A growth mindset, coachability, and willingness to roll up your sleeves.

About the Company

  • Sierra is creating a platform to help businesses build better, more human customer experiences with AI.
  • We are guided by a set of values: Trust, Customer Obsession, Craftsmanship, Intensity, and Family.
  • Our co-founders are Bret Taylor and Clay Bavor, with extensive experience in technology leadership roles at companies like Salesforce, Facebook, Google, and OpenAI.
